Name | PINX1 |
---|---|
Synonyms | LPTL, LPTS |
Function | Microtubule-binding protein essential for faithful chromosome segregation. Mediates TRF1 and TERT accumulation in nucleolus and enhances TRF1 binding to telomeres. Inhibits telomerase activity. May inhibit cell proliferation and act as tumor suppressor. |
Cellular Location | Nucleus. Nucleus, nucleolus. Chromosome, telomere. Chromosome, centromere, kinetochore Note=Localizes in nucleoli, at telomere speckles and to the outer plate of kinetochores. Localization to the kinetochore is mediated by its central region and depends on NDC80 and CENPE |
Tissue Location | Ubiquitous; expressed at low levels. Not detectable in a number of hepatocarcinoma cell lines |
